On Thursday, May 15, Lomé was the venue for an unprecedented gathering bringing together professionals from the Togolese public sector around a topic of paramount importance: "The digitalisation of public administrations: challenges and prospects". This event, initiated by ST DIGITAL, aimed to strengthen understanding of digital challenges and to propose concrete solutions to modernise Togolese public services.


After a successful first stage in Yaoundé, this meeting in Lomé was designed to be even more ambitious in terms of mobilisation and experience sharing. Participants were fully engaged, aware that digital transformation is now an indispensable lever for administrative efficiency and citizen satisfaction. In Togo, the Ministry of Digital Economy and Digital Transformation, in collaboration with the Togo Digitale Agency (ATD), is actively working to structure this transition. Their ambition is clear: to make digital technology a performance driver for the public sector, in the service of both the population and businesses.

The challenges of digitalising public administrations

The exchanges among participants highlighted several challenges faced by Togolese administrations:


  • Accessibility to modern digital infrastructure: Some administrations still face difficulties in acquiring high-performance and interconnected tools.
  • Training of public servants: To achieve digital transformation, it is essential to support teams with tailored training programmes.
  • Data management and cybersecurity: Protecting sensitive information remains a critical point in the implementation of digital services.
  • Embracing change: Cultural and organisational resistance can hinder the adoption of new digital practices.


The Ministry of Digital Economy and Digital Transformation, with the support of the ATD, has already initiated several projects to address these challenges. Among recent actions, we can cite:


  • The implementation of digital portals for administrative procedures.
  • Awareness and training campaigns on the use of technologies.
  • The development of initiatives to strengthen the cybersecurity of public data.
